Transaction cdf80e99a3fc6bf5565c354e738244f1af941f099e5d214dec955f105791a261
1 Input
1 Output
-
cdf80e99a3fc6bf5565c354e738244f1af941f099e5d214dec955f105791a261:0
- value
- 3773804
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68793cf9632fafd063d82c34cbb8f7d64b2c12da OP_EQUAL
- address
- 3BDRSGeSWaR33tdhHkVdeiN2dwLag64T3H